Sewing Zone
- Ceiling tiles are mostly installed, some are out for electrical work. Next buildout meet, there should be some visible progress on door framing/hanging. Table design is progressing, materials purchase is planned for April 25. Member storage bar was hung last week. Task lists on slack show main room tasks and another task list of (fun) projects that fully furnish the room, broken out by skill.

Storage Zone
- Aj is regularly providing updates on Storage happenings in the storage slack channel. If you want more regular info / updates, feel free to join the channel.
- Can the template for meeting minutes be updated to reflect the current Zone list? (I'm adding Storage to the list, and I believe there's others missing / out of order)
- I made a simple Google form where people can submit any ideas or feedback they have about Storage: https://docs.google.com/forms/d/e/1FAIpQLSd3xm_4f9ol00335rfXX7BIzRLvl-sHDUuzcFw1PCeFhv_BLQ/viewform?usp=sharing
- It's anonymous as long as you don't provide identifying info.
- All claimed storage plots that have updated labels have been given an index card with contact info. If your plot isn't labelled, it's because you don't have it claimed in the CRM.
- Labels still need up be updated for the lockers and laser storage plots (and the highest up wood pylon plots)
- Cosplay SIG materials have been removed from member storage, and are now located above the vending machines. Ideally, i3, zone, and SIG storage will be separate from member personal storage (in progress)
- I'm looking into some changes and requests that may require proposals and approvals. Unfortunately I wasn't able to get any on schedule 10 days prior to this meeting, but giving a quick overview:
- Starting up a new version of Storage reaping
- Potential formation of a Storage Committee
- Updating the format of parking permits and parking tickets
- Looking into short term 'active project' / 'this is drying' storage
Several favorable comments about the recent energy in storage.

Additional items from the floor
Frank wants to point out that some time ago we approved budgets to move to a new CRM. That got some work and got put on hold a while, has restarted activity, it looks like there's a solution that can do everything we want, membership, storage, onboarding, etc. They're meeting with a company rep next monday! Will soft-start with a few members. HelloClub is the name. It has resource bookings and calendar integration and stuff. Paul L makes a "gym members" joke about people who pay their dues and never show up. It should be able to produce an export that goes to the door controller, but it's not keeping active track of the door swipes. We can set rules on when overdue members can no longer open the door, etc. What's the cost? Up to $100/mo was approved, our package we're looking at should be about $80-something a month. Sounds like they're throwing in API access for free but that's not certain, might be around 160/mo if we have to pay for the API. It's likely to be a big lift to get every member's billing moved over, since individuals will have to restart transactions in the new system, but that's for later.
